Klavis AI offers live environments designed for the training of AI agents, focusing on coding and agentic tool-use tasks. The platform delivers both coding-oriented and tool-use datasets that emphasize long-horizon tasks, programmatic verification, and granular reward structures. It caters to scenarios where agents must perform complex activities such as code editing, test writing, debugging, and interacting with real-world tools and SaaS applications.
For coding agent data, Klavis AI provides a range of task types including short coding prompts and extended, long-horizon coding challenges. These tasks are supported by features such as manual review, programmatic verification, binary pass/fail rewards, and more nuanced, granular reward systems. The environments are offered in Dockerized formats to facilitate local setup and reproducibility, and they support iterative code, test, and debug workflows. This infrastructure allows for deterministic tests and is suitable for reinforcement learning (RL) and supervised fine-tuning (SFT) procedures.
On the agentic tool-use side, Klavis AI supplies data involving demo-only tool calls and long-horizon workflows across a selection of over 600 real tools and SaaS applications. These tasks are structured as static task worlds or state-mutating workflows, with rewards that may be subjective, rubric-based, or determined by language models. The platform’s tool-use data is designed to simulate realistic workflows with logically consistent state, noisy inputs, and verifiable outcomes, making it relevant for developing frontier agents intended to interact with real production environments.
Klavis AI is aimed at users such as AI labs and researchers who are building and evaluating advanced agentic systems. The platform highlights its ability to deliver high-quality, realistic data and environments for the development and assessment of AI agents on complex, real-world tasks.
